Why Might Wearing a Mask Cause Tiredness?
Wearing a mask might cause tiredness due to several physiological and psychological factors that affect the body and mind. This sensation often described as “mask fatigue,” can make individuals feel depleted or exhausted after extended periods of use.
The World Health Organization (WHO) underscores the importance of masks in reducing the spread of respiratory infections, but they also acknowledge potential discomforts associated with prolonged use, including fatigue.
Several underlying causes contribute to tiredness while wearing a mask:
-
Breathing Resistance: Masks can create physical resistance to breathing. As air travels through the fabric, it can require more effort to inhale and exhale.
-
Carbon Dioxide Accumulation: Masks impede some airflow, leading to a slight buildup of carbon dioxide (CO2). This occurs if an individual is taking shallow breaths or wearing a mask for a long time.
-
Physical Discomfort: The materials and fit of a mask can cause discomfort. Tight-fitting masks can place pressure on the face and ears, leading to physical fatigue.
-
Cognitive Load: Being aware of one’s mask and the surrounding safety measures can increase mental fatigue. This constant focus can tire an individual out more quickly.
The mechanisms behind these factors are straightforward. Breathing through a mask requires changes in airflow dynamics. The resistance may provoke a need for deeper or more frequent breaths, potentially resulting in an increased heart rate and elevated oxygen demand. While this does not pose a significant health risk for most people, over time, it can lead to feelings of fatigue.
Specific conditions and actions contribute to this issue:
-
Prolonged Usage: Wearing masks for several hours without breaks can amplify tiredness, especially in individuals engaging in physically demanding activities.
-
Physical Activity: Exercising while wearing a mask can exacerbate feelings of tiredness due to heightened breathing resistance and oxygen limitations.
-
Stressful Environments: Situations that cause anxiety or stress can further drain energy levels. For instance, navigating crowded spaces while wearing a mask may heighten cognitive load.
Recognizing these factors can help individuals manage their energy levels effectively while complying with safety measures. Taking breaks, choosing comfortable masks, and practicing good breathing techniques can alleviate the feeling of tiredness associated with mask-wearing.

Is There a Difference in Fatigue Levels Between N95 Masks and Cloth Masks?
Yes, there is a difference in fatigue levels between N95 masks and cloth masks. Generally, N95 masks can cause more discomfort and fatigue due to their tighter fit and higher filtration efficiency, compared to the looser fit of cloth masks.
N95 masks are designed for medical settings and offer a higher level of protection against airborne particles. They seal tightly to the face, which can make breathing more effortful, particularly during prolonged use. In contrast, cloth masks provide a looser fit and are typically more comfortable for longer wear. A study published in the Journal of Occupational and Environmental Hygiene (Bae, 2021) found that users reported increased fatigue while wearing N95 masks in comparison to cloth masks during extended periods.
The positive aspect of N95 masks is their effectiveness in filtering out at least 95% of particulate matter, including viruses. This high filtration efficiency is critical in healthcare settings and during an infectious disease outbreak. A study by the Centers for Disease Control and Prevention (CDC) emphasized that N95 masks significantly reduce the risk of transmission of respiratory infections (CDC, 2020).
On the negative side, N95 masks can lead to discomfort after prolonged usage. The physical stress due to the mask’s tight fit may increase feelings of fatigue, particularly in individuals with respiratory issues. Research by Zhang et al. (2022) indicated that wearing N95 masks for long durations can lead to symptoms like dizziness and breathing difficulties, especially during physical activity.
For optimal use, consider the context in which you’ll be wearing a mask. For situations requiring high protection, such as healthcare or crowded environments, opt for an N95 mask but limit the time of use if fatigue is a concern. For casual use, cloth masks may be more appropriate due to their comfort. Always ensure that whichever mask you choose fits well and is comfortable for extended periods.
How Can You Reduce Fatigue Associated with Wearing a Mask?
You can reduce fatigue associated with wearing a mask by ensuring proper fit, taking breaks when possible, choosing breathable materials, practicing mindful breathing, and staying hydrated.
Proper fit: A well-fitting mask should sit snugly against your face without causing pressure on your ears or nose. An ill-fitting mask can create discomfort and increase fatigue. The CDC recommends fitting masks to cover both your nose and mouth securely without gaps.
Breaks: If safe to do so, take short breaks from wearing the mask every 30 minutes. This allows for fresh air and prevents prolonged fatigue. For example, stepping outside or finding a private space can provide relief from mask-wearing stress.
Breathable materials: Selecting masks made from lightweight, breathable fabrics can significantly reduce discomfort. Studies show that cotton masks provide breathability, reducing the perception of fatigue. For instance, a study by M. M. Tharakan et al. (2020) highlighted that cotton masks allow better airflow compared to synthetic materials.
Mindful breathing: Practice deep and slow breathing. Focusing on your breathing helps to calm the nervous system and can reduce the feeling of fatigue. Techniques such as inhaling for a count of four, holding for a count of four, and exhaling for a count of four can promote relaxation.
Hydration: Staying hydrated is crucial, as dehydration can exacerbate feelings of fatigue. According to a study by J. K. Cheuvront et al. (2009), even mild dehydration can impair physical performance and cognitive function. Drinking adequate water throughout the day may help you feel more energized while wearing a mask.
By adopting these strategies, you can effectively minimize fatigue associated with prolonged mask use.
